Tag: dependency-properties

Eine Eigenschaft, die in WPF und Silverlight unterstützt Datenbindung, einschließlich Stile, Vererbung, animation und Standard-Werte. Es ermöglicht Ihnen, legen Sie angefügte Eigenschaften auf DependencyObject.

Abhängigkeit Eigenschaft zugewiesen mit dem Wert Bindung funktioniert nicht

Anzahl der Antworten 2 Antworten
Ich habe ein usercontrol mit einer Abhängigkeitseigenschaft. public sealed partial class PenMenu : UserControl, INotifyPropertyChanged { public event PropertyChangedEventHandler PropertyChanged; protected void OnPropertyChanged(string propertyName) { if (PropertyChanged != null) { PropertyChanged(this, new PropertyChangedEventArgs(propertyName)); } } public bool

WPF-Benutzer Control Hölle mit MVVM und Dependency Properties

Anzahl der Antworten 4 Antworten
Dies ist, was ich versuche zu tun: Ich Schreibe ein UserControl ich will konsumiert werden, die von anderen Entwicklern. Ich soll den Endanwender in der Lage, um meine Kontrolle über abhängigkeitseigenschaften. <lib:ControlView ControlsText={Binding Path=UsersOwnViewModelText} /> Ich bin

DependencyProperty Default-Wert

Anzahl der Antworten 1 Antworten
Ich versuche zu bekommen eine DependencyProperty-arbeiten in WPF. Ich bin mit: public static readonly DependencyProperty DisplayModeProperty = DependencyProperty.Register("DisplayMode", typeof (TescoFoodSummary), typeof (Orientation), new UIPropertyMetadata(Orientation.Vertical)); ///<summary> ///Gets or sets the orientation. ///</summary> ///<value>The orientation.</value> public Orientation DisplayMode {

Wie ist WPF DependencyObject umgesetzt?

Anzahl der Antworten 1 Antworten
Gibt es irgendwelche Artikel, die beschreiben, wie die DependencyObject Klasse in WPF arbeitet "unter der Haube"? Insbesondere bin ich neugierig, wie dependency properties gespeichert sind und effizient zugegriffen. Es ist ein bisschen von detail hier in diesem

Erstellen Sie schnell dependency properties im VS

Anzahl der Antworten 4 Antworten
Gibt es eine Möglichkeit, wie die Geschwindigkeit die Abhängigkeit von Eigenschaften erstellen, die in VS? Wie einige Vorlage oder refractoring option, macht Abhängigkeitseigenschaft, die aus dem normalen one. Nichts. Ich erstelle eine Menge von abhängigkeitseigenschaften jetzt... Danke

Abhängigkeit Eigenschaft wird nicht aktualisiert, mein Usercontrol

Anzahl der Antworten 1 Antworten
In der Zeile darunter Werke für das TextBox-DP Textwo CellNo ist eine Eigenschaft einer Klasse, abgeleitet von INotifyPropertychanged. Also, wenn ich hier ändern Sie die CellNo der Text wird aktualisiert und Wenn ich die CellNo der Text

WPF ValidationRule mit Abhängigkeitseigenschaft

Anzahl der Antworten 1 Antworten
Angenommen, Sie haben eine Klasse erbt, die von ValidationRule: public class MyValidationRule : ValidationRule { public string ValidationType { get; set; } public override ValidationResult Validate(object value, CultureInfo cultureInfo) {} } in XAML, die Sie überprüfen möchten,

Wie zu verwenden PropertyChangedCallBack

Anzahl der Antworten 1 Antworten
Ich habe eine TextBox Gebunden sind, um eine Abhängigkeit Eigenschaft, die ich umgesetzt haben, eine PropertyChangedCallBack Funktion, wenn der text ändert muss ich anrufen textbox.ScrollToEnd() aber ich kann da die PropertChanged Funktion muss statisch sein soll, gibt

Gewusst wie: Debuggen von DependencyProperty.Unsetvalue Fehler, wenn die InnerException ist null

Anzahl der Antworten 4 Antworten
Habe ich eine benutzerdefinierte login-Benutzersteuerelement, das ist ein normales Textfeld und eine passwordbox. Mischung weigert zu kooperieren mit der PasswordBox sagen, dass "DP.UnsetValue" ist nicht gültig für die PasswordChar-Eigenschaft. Aber das Projekt kompiliert und läuft einwandfrei in

Wpf UserControl und MVVM

Anzahl der Antworten 3 Antworten
Denke ich über Schreibe eine WPF-Benutzer Control für meine Anwendung. Ich bin mit MVVM in meiner Anwendung. Benutzer-Steuerelement kann verlangen, Dependency Properties, die gesetzt werden können, meine Eltern Anzuzeigen. bei der Verwendung von MVVM, die Idee ist,

Wie verwende ich Attached-Eigenschaft in einem Stil?

Anzahl der Antworten 1 Antworten
Ich erstellt habe, ein Bild innerhalb eines ButtonStyle. Nun habe ich erstellt eine Angefügte Eigenschaft, so dass ich die Quelle für das Bild. Sollte einfach sein, aber ich bin mit ihm stecken. Dies ist mein gekürzt ButtonStyle:

Setter nicht auf Abhängigkeitseigenschaften ausgeführt?

Anzahl der Antworten 2 Antworten
Nur eine kurze Frage, zu klären, einige Zweifel. Sind setter nicht ausgeführt, wenn ein element gebunden ist, um eine Abhängigkeitseigenschaft? public string TextContent { get { return (string)GetValue(TextContentProperty); } set { SetValue(TextContentProperty, value); Debug.WriteLine("Setting value of TextContent:

Twoway-Bindung der DependencyProperty an Viewmodels Eigenschaft?

Anzahl der Antworten 3 Antworten
Mehrere Quellen auf dem Netz erzählt uns, dass in MVVM Kommunikation/Synchronisation zwischen views und viewmodels passieren sollte, über abhängigkeitseigenschaften. Wenn verstehe ich das richtig, eine dependency property der view gebunden werden, eine Eigenschaft des viewmodel-mit zwei-Wege-Bindung. Nun,

Hören Sie Änderungen der Abhängigkeitseigenschaft zu

Anzahl der Antworten 6 Antworten
Gibt es eine Möglichkeit, zu hören, um die Veränderungen der DependencyProperty? Ich möchte benachrichtigt werden, und führen Sie einige Aktionen ausführen, wenn der Wert ändert, aber ich kann nicht die Bindung. Es ist ein DependencyProperty einer anderen

Was sind die Standardeinstellungen für Binding.Mode = Standard für WPF-Steuerelemente?

Anzahl der Antworten 3 Antworten
In WPF Bindung.- Modusbei der Auswahl Standardes hängt in der Immobilie gebunden. Ich bin auf der Suche nach Liste oder einige übereinkommen oder jede information, für die Standardwerte für die verschiedenen Kontrollen. Ich meine, welche Eigenschaften sind

Wie erstellen Sie eine schreibgeschützte Abhängigkeitseigenschaft?

Anzahl der Antworten 1 Antworten
Wie erstellen Sie eine nur-lese-Abhängigkeit Eigenschaft? Was sind die besten Methoden dafür? Speziell, was die guckten mich die meisten, ist die Tatsache, dass es keine Umsetzung von DependencyObject.GetValue() nimmt System.Windows.DependencyPropertyKey als parameter. System.Windows.DependencyProperty.RegisterReadOnly gibt ein DependencyPropertyKey -

Warum erhalte ich DependencyProperty.UnsetValue beim Konvertieren eines Werts in einem MultiBinding?

Anzahl der Antworten 1 Antworten
Habe ich eine extrem einfache IMultiValueConverter, ODER einfach nur zwei Werte. Im Beispiel unten, ich will umkehren den ersten Wert mit einer ebenso einfachen boolean-Wechselrichter. <MultiBinding Converter="{StaticResource multiBoolToVis}"> <Binding Path="ConditionA" Converter="{StaticResource boolInverter}"/> <Binding Path="ConditionB"/> </MultiBinding> - und

Vererbte Mitglieder verstecken

Anzahl der Antworten 8 Antworten
Ich bin auf der Suche nach einem Weg, um effektiv zu verstecken geerbten member. Ich habe eine Bibliothek von Klassen, die Erben von gemeinsamen Basisklassen. Einige der neueren abgeleiteten Klassen Erben die Abhängigkeit von Eigenschaften, die zu

INotifyPropertyChanged vs. DependencyProperty in ViewModel

Anzahl der Antworten 14 Antworten
Bei der Implementierung von ViewModel in einer Model-View-ViewModel-Architektur WPF-Anwendung scheint es zwei wichtige Entscheidungen, wie man es databindable. Ich habe gesehen, Implementierungen, Verwendung DependencyProperty für die Eigenschaften der Ansicht ist, gehen, zu binden und gegen die ich

Was ist der Unterschied zwischen einer Abhängigkeitseigenschaft und einer angefügten Eigenschaft in WPF?

Anzahl der Antworten 5 Antworten
Was ist der Unterschied zwischen einem (benutzerdefinierten) Abhängigkeitseigenschaft und eine angefügte Eigenschaft in WPF? Was sind die Anwendungen für jeden? Wie die Umsetzungen in der Regel Verschieden? InformationsquelleAutor der Frage kenwarner | 2009-08-06

Fehler beim Entfernen der Projektabhängigkeit in VS2010

Anzahl der Antworten 6 Antworten
Habe ich noch eine große Lösung, mit der Anzahl der Projekte. Einige der Projekte sind abhängig von anderen (nie eine zirkuläre Abhängigkeit). Als ich versuchte, entfernen die Abhängigkeit von einem Projekt, erhalte ich eine Fehlermeldung wie "Die

Warum Abhängigkeitseigenschaften?

Anzahl der Antworten 2 Antworten
Warum Microsoft gehen die Strecke von dependency properties dependency-Objekte anstelle von Reflexion und vielleicht Attribute? InformationsquelleAutor der Frage Mr Bell | 2009-11-12

An die benutzerdefinierte Abhängigkeitseigenschaft binden - erneut

Anzahl der Antworten 1 Antworten
OK, ich weiß. Dieser wurde aufgefordert, buchstäblich eine million mal, aber ich noch nicht bekommen. Tut mir Leid. Aufgabe: implementieren Sie die einfachste Abhängigkeitseigenschaft immer, die verwendet werden können in xaml so: <uc:MyUserControl1 MyTextProperty="{Binding Text}"/> Ich denke,

Wann sollte eine WPF-Abhängigkeitseigenschaft im Vergleich zu INotifyPropertyChanged verwendet werden?

Anzahl der Antworten 5 Antworten
Tun, die Leute haben keine Führung, wenn eine einfache .NET-Eigenschaft, feuert INotifyPropertyChanged.PropertyChanged ist ausreichend in ein view-Modell? Dann, wenn Sie verschieben möchten, bis zu einer ausgewachsenen Abhängigkeit Eigenschaft? Oder sind die DPs in Erster Linie für Ansichten?

Benutzerdefinierte Steuerabhängigkeitseigenschaftsbindung

Anzahl der Antworten 1 Antworten
Ich werde verrückt versuchen, diese arbeiten selbst mit den meisten basic-Beispiel. Ich kann nicht für das Leben von mir bekommen die Bindung zu arbeiten. Hier ist ein super einfaches Beispiel, das nicht funktioniert für mich. Ich MUSS

Wie binden Sie an eine WPF-Abhängigkeitseigenschaft, wenn der Datenkontext der Seite für andere Bindungen verwendet wird?

Anzahl der Antworten 2 Antworten
How zu binden, um eine WPF-Abhängigkeit-Eigenschaft, wenn der datacontext der page auch für andere Bindungen? (Einfache Frage) InformationsquelleAutor der Frage Thomas Bratt | 2009-04-21

Gibt es eine Möglichkeit, den Standard-Bindungsmodus einer benutzerdefinierten Abhängigkeitseigenschaft und den Aktualisierungstrigger anzugeben?

Anzahl der Antworten 2 Antworten
Ich möchte es so machen, dass als Standard, wenn ich das binden an eine meiner dependency properties der binding-Modus-zwei-Wege-und update-trigger-Eigenschaft verändert. Gibt es eine Möglichkeit, dies zu tun? Hier ist ein Beispiel einer meiner Abhängigkeit Eigenschaften: public

Eine 'Bindung' kann nur für eine DependencyProperty eines DependencyObject festgelegt werden

Anzahl der Antworten 6 Antworten
Aus einem benutzerdefinierten Steuerelement basierend auf TextBox habe ich eine Eigenschaft namens Items auf diese Weise: public class NewTextBox : TextBox { public ItemCollection Items { get; set; } } Wenn das custom control in XAML, ich

Wie bindet man das einfach an ConverterParameter?

Anzahl der Antworten 2 Antworten
Ich habe ein problem und ich weiß nicht, wie dieses Problem zu lösen einfach, ich habe viele Punkte wie diese, dann die Lösung sollte nicht kompliziert. Habe ich Haupt-Projekt mit Einstellungen und die wichtigsten XAML. Ich habe

DependencyProperty.Register () oder .RegisterAttached ()

Anzahl der Antworten 3 Antworten
Was ist der Unterschied zwischen den beiden, Wann sollte RegisterAttached() verwendet werden, statt .Register()? InformationsquelleAutor der Frage Sander Rijken | 2009-05-26

Die ObservableCollection-Abhängigkeitseigenschaft wird nicht aktualisiert, wenn das Element in der Auflistung gelöscht wird

Anzahl der Antworten 3 Antworten
Ich habe eine angefügte Eigenschaft vom Typ ObservableCollection auf ein Steuerelement. Wenn ich hinzufügen oder entfernen von Objekten aus der Sammlung, die ui aktualisiert sich nicht. Allerdings, wenn ich ersetzen Sie die Sammlung in eine neue ViewModel

Was ist der Unterschied zwischen Property und Dependency Property?

Anzahl der Antworten 5 Antworten
Abhängigkeit von Eigenschaften erstellt werden, genauso wie Eigenschaften. Ist eine dependency property verwendet, nur, während Sie ein benutzerdefiniertes Steuerelement erstellen? InformationsquelleAutor der Frage | 2010-09-09

Was ist der Unterschied zwischen Dependency-Eigenschaft SetValue () & amp; SetCurrentValue ()

Anzahl der Antworten 2 Antworten
Der Grund warum ich Frage dies, weil ich empfohlen wurde von @Greg D (von diese Frage) zu verwenden SetCurrentValue() statt, aber ein Blick in die docs nicht sehen, was ist der Unterschied. Oder was bedeutet "ohne änderung

Was ist eine Abhängigkeitseigenschaft?

Anzahl der Antworten 4 Antworten
Was ist eine Abhängigkeitseigenschaft .Net (vor allem im WPF-Kontext). Was ist der Unterschied von der normalen Eigenschaft? InformationsquelleAutor der Frage edgi | 2009-03-06

Höre auf DependencyProperty, ändere das Ereignis und erhalte den alten Wert

Anzahl der Antworten 2 Antworten
Ich habe den folgenden code zu abonnieren Eigenschaft geändert-Ereignis für VisiblePosition Eigenschaft von Column Klasse: DependencyPropertyDescriptor dpd = DependencyPropertyDescriptor.FromProperty(ColumnBase.VisiblePositionProperty, typeof(Column)); if (dpd != null) { dpd.AddValueChanged(col, ColumnVisiblePositionChangedHandler); } Hier ist die definition der ColumnVisiblePositionChangedHandler Methode: static internal